案例分享:仓库对接100.05.03
在现代企业的运营中,数据集成已成为提升效率和优化资源配置的关键环节。本案例聚焦于如何通过“仓库对接100.05.03”方案,将旺店通·企业奇门的数据无缝集成到金蝶云星空平台。此过程不仅需要高效的数据传输能力,还需确保数据的完整性和实时性。
首先,我们利用旺店通·企业奇门提供的API接口wdt.warehouse.query
进行数据抓取。该接口支持定时可靠的数据获取,确保在高并发环境下不漏单,并能处理分页和限流问题,从而保证数据的完整性。在数据传输过程中,通过轻易云平台提供的集中监控和告警系统,我们能够实时跟踪每个任务的状态与性能,及时发现并解决潜在问题。
为了适应不同平台间的数据格式差异,我们采用自定义的数据转换逻辑,使得从旺店通·企业奇门到金蝶云星空的数据映射更加精准。同时,金蝶云星空API batchSave
的高吞吐量特性允许我们批量写入大量数据,大幅提升了处理效率。此外,为了应对可能出现的异常情况,我们设计了完善的错误重试机制,以确保数据对接过程中的稳定性和可靠性。
通过这些技术手段,本方案不仅实现了旺店通·企业奇门与金蝶云星空之间的数据无缝集成,还为后续业务决策提供了强有力的数据支持。
调用旺店通·企业奇门接口wdt.warehouse.query获取与加工数据
在轻易云数据集成平台的生命周期中,调用源系统接口是至关重要的一步。本文将深入探讨如何通过调用旺店通·企业奇门接口wdt.warehouse.query
来获取和处理仓库数据。
接口调用与元数据配置
首先,我们需要理解接口的基本配置。根据提供的元数据配置,wdt.warehouse.query
接口采用POST方法进行请求。关键参数包括:
- warehouse_no:作为唯一标识符,用于确保每个仓库记录的唯一性。
- 分页机制:通过设置
page_size
和page_no
来控制每次请求的数据量和页码,从而有效管理大规模数据的抓取。
分页机制是处理大量数据时不可或缺的一部分。在本例中,默认每页返回50条记录,这样可以在保证性能的同时减少网络负载。
数据请求与清洗
在请求阶段,需要特别注意参数的正确传递。例如,字段“type”用于指定仓库类型,其值必须准确无误,以确保返回的数据符合预期。此外,通过启用ID检查(idCheck),我们可以避免重复记录进入后续的数据处理流程。
一旦成功获取到原始数据,就需要对其进行清洗。这一步骤通常包括格式化日期、去除冗余字段以及标准化数值单位等操作。这些操作不仅提高了数据质量,还为后续的数据转换奠定了基础。
处理分页与限流问题
由于API可能会对请求频率进行限制,因此在设计集成方案时需考虑限流策略。常见的方法包括:
- 批量请求:利用分页功能分批次获取数据。
- 重试机制:当遇到超时或其他错误时,通过设定重试次数和间隔时间来确保任务完成。
这些措施能够有效地提升系统的稳定性和可靠性,避免因单次请求失败导致整个流程中断。
数据转换与写入准备
经过清洗后的数据,需要根据目标系统(如金蝶云星空)的要求进行格式转换。这可能涉及到字段映射、编码转换等操作。在此过程中,自定义的数据转换逻辑显得尤为重要,它允许我们根据具体业务需求调整输出结果,以实现最佳兼容性。
最后,为了确保高效的数据写入,应提前规划好批量写入策略,并结合实时监控工具,对整个过程进行跟踪和优化。这不仅能提升整体效率,还能及时发现并解决潜在问题。
综上所述,通过合理配置和调用旺店通·企业奇门接口,我们能够高效地获取并加工仓库相关数据,为后续的数据集成奠定坚实基础。
数据集成生命周期的ETL转换:从源平台到金蝶云星空
在数据集成过程中,将源平台的数据转换为目标平台所需格式是关键的一步。本文聚焦于如何通过ETL(Extract, Transform, Load)过程,将旺店通·企业奇门系统的数据转化为金蝶云星空API接口可接收的格式,并成功写入目标平台。
ETL转换中的关键步骤
首先,数据提取(Extract)阶段,我们需要从旺店通·企业奇门接口定时可靠地抓取数据。通过调用wdt.warehouse.query
接口,我们可以获得仓库相关信息。这一步需要处理接口的分页和限流问题,以确保数据完整性和高效性。
接下来是数据转换(Transform)阶段,这是将源数据转化为目标平台格式的核心环节。在这个过程中,必须处理旺店通·企业奇门与金蝶云星空之间的数据格式差异。为此,轻易云平台提供了自定义数据转换逻辑,可以根据特定业务需求调整数据结构。例如,通过元数据配置中的ConvertObjectParser
,我们能够实现字段值的格式化和映射,如将使用组织和创建组织字段解析为标准编码。
数据写入金蝶云星空
在加载(Load)阶段,我们使用金蝶云星空API的batchSave
方法进行批量数据写入。该方法支持高吞吐量的数据写入能力,使得大量仓库信息能够快速集成到金蝶云星空中。这不仅提高了处理效率,还确保了集成过程不漏单。
具体操作中,我们需要注意以下几点:
-
批量处理:利用
batchArraySave
操作,每次处理50行数据,通过array
键进行批量传输。这种方式不仅优化了网络资源,还加快了写入速度。 -
验证基础资料:配置项中包括是否验证基础资料有效性的选项,通过设置
IsVerifyBaseDataField
为false,可以跳过不必要的验证过程,提高效率。 -
自动提交与审核:为了简化流程并确保数据准确性,配置中设置了自动提交并审核功能,通过将
IsAutoSubmitAndAudit
设为true,实现无缝对接。 -
异常处理与重试机制:在对接过程中可能出现异常情况,为此我们设计了错误重试机制,确保在发生错误时能够及时重试并恢复正常操作。
实时监控与优化
整个ETL转换过程可以通过轻易云平台提供的实时监控系统进行跟踪。该系统不仅记录每个步骤的日志,还提供告警功能以便及时发现并处理潜在问题。同时,通过统一视图和控制台,可以全面掌握API资产使用情况,实现资源的高效利用和优化配置。
总之,成功实现旺店通·企业奇门到金蝶云星空的数据集成,不仅依赖于精准的ETL转换,更需要强大的技术支持和实时监控能力,以确保整个过程顺畅无误。